Clean indoor air laws encourage bans on smoking at home

eurekalert.org — “There has been concern that clean indoor air laws might encourage smokers to smoke more in their homes or other private venues. Children living in a home with an adult smoker are up to twice as likely to take up smoking themselves. A study in the American Journal of Preventive Medicine concludes that strong clean indoor air laws are associated with large increases in voluntary smoke-free policies in the home, as well.View full resource at eurekalert.org

Kids Of Parents Who Smoke At Home Miss More School : Shots - Health Blog : NPR

npr.org — “Children living with a smoker in the house miss about one extra school day per year. And if two adults in the house smoke, children miss 1.54 more days compared to kids from nonsmoking households.View full resource at npr.org
